Myanmar Military Burns Rohingya Civilians
Attacks of 30 Myanmar police and military posts by Rohingya militants have long tails. With cunning tactics, the Myanmar military burned down a mosque that was being used for dawn prayers in congregation.
"They are killing civilians who are praying, they are really devils," shouted Hasan (32), as quoted from TheAsiaGuardian.com
At least hundreds of innocent people became victims of the sadistic burning. Moreover, the burned mosque is one of the refuge of Rohingya.
The government of Myanmar has not issued any statement regarding the brutal action.
Meanwhile, fighting is still going on around the town of Rathedaung, where there has been a buildup of Myanmar troops in recent weeks.
"Military and police members are battling Bengali extremist terrorists," said Min Aung Hlaing, the country's supreme commander of the armed forces, in a statement that uses country descriptions for the Rohingya militant group.
"People are hiding, especially parents and women," said Hla Tun, a Rohingya man from a village close to the battle site, to the Guardian.
